40th Annual Aqua Pentathlon (First event in 1979 at Eastridge Kankakee, moved to Waubonsie in 1986). Swimmers compete in 5 events. 50 Free – each tenth of a second is worth 5 points, 100 Fly, 100 Back and 100 Breaststroke – each tenth is worth 2 points and the final event is 200 Free – each tenth is worth 1 point. The swimmer is challenged in 5 different ways with a sprint and a middle distance event as well as the ability to swim all strokes well. You need to be more than an IM swimmer.
Most Aqua Pentathlons are done as a 100 of each stroke and a 200 IM. The winner is the individual with the lowest combined time. I consider this as a broken 400 IM and a 200 IM swim. I feel this is really and IM meet. Yes there are 5 events but only one challenge -are you an IMer.
